Kaip gauti minimalią vertę naudojant „Excel“ funkciją IF

Anonim

Šiame straipsnyje sužinosime, kaip gauti minimalią vertę, jei „Excel“ sąlyga yra „True“.

Paprastais žodžiais tariant, kai dirbame su ilgais duomenų lapais, kartais turime išgauti mažiausią vertę, jei sąlyga yra teisinga, pavyzdžiui, surasti prisijungimo datą pagal darbuotojo kodą.

Paimkime bendrąją formulę tam

{= MIN (IF (diapazonas = kriterijai, vertės))}

diapazonas = kriterijai: masyvo sąlyga
Vertės: atitinkamas masyvas, kuriame reikia rasti mažiausią vertę

Pastaba:
Abu masyvo ilgiai turi būti vienodi
Nenaudokite garbanotų petnešų rankiniu būdu, NAUDOTI Ctrl + Shift + Enter o ne tik įveskite užpildę formulę.

Supraskime šią funkciją naudodami pavyzdį.

Čia mes nurodome produktų galiojimo datą ir turime rasti anksčiausią konkrečių produktų galiojimo datą.

Tam padės „Excel MIN & IF“ funkcijos.

Mes naudosime produkto „Arrowroot“ formulę:

{= MIN (IF (B2: B26 = D2, A2: A26))}

Paaiškinimas:
B2: B26: diapazonas, kuriame formulė atitinka produkto pavadinimą D2 langelyje ir pateikia masyvą TRUE (1s) & FALSE (0s).
A2: A26: Galiojimo laikas, atitinkantis diapazoną, padauginamas

Formulė nukrenta iki
= MIN (IF ({0; 0; 0; 0; 0; 0; 0; 0; TRUE; 0; 0; 0; 0; 0; TRUE; 0; 0; 0; 0; 0; TRUE; 0; 0; 0; 0}, {43538; 43535; 43532; 43529; 43526; 43523; 43520; 43517; 43514; 43511; 43508; 43505; 0; 43499; 43496; 43493; 43490; 43487; 43484; 43481; 43478; 43475; 43472; 43469; 43466}))

{0;0;0;0;0;0;0;0;43514;0;0;0;0;0;43496;0;0;0;0;0;43478;0;0;0;0}

Ši formulė pateikia minimalią vertę, atitinkančią visas TRUE reikšmes

Konvertuokite langelio formatą į datą naudodami „Excel“ langelio formato parinktį.

2019-01-13 yra ankstyviausia rodyklės galiojimo pabaigos data.

Naudokite produkto morkų formulę

{= MIN (IF (B2: B26 = D3, A2: A26))}


Kaip matote Ši formulė grąžina ankstyviausią konkretaus produkto galiojimo datą (minimalią vertę).

Jei naudojate versiją „Excel 2016“ per OFFICE 365, naudokite „Excel MINIFS“ funkciją:

= MINIFS (vertės, diapazonas, kriterijai)

Tikimės, kad supratote, kaip gauti minimalią vertę naudojant „Excel“ funkciją IF. Čia rasite daugiau straipsnių apie „Excel“ logines funkcijas. Nedvejodami pareikškite savo užklausą ar atsiliepimą apie aukščiau pateiktą straipsnį.

Kaip naudoti funkciją „SMALL“ programoje „Excel“

Kaip apskaičiuoti maksimumą, jei sąlygos atitinka „Excel“

Kaip naudotis funkcija LARGE programoje „Excel“

Kaip naudoti „MAX“ funkciją „Excel“

Gaunama pirmoji sąrašo vertė, kuri yra didesnė / mažesnė nei nurodyta „Excel“ vertė

Populiarūs straipsniai:
Kaip naudotis „VLOOKUP“ funkcija „Excel“
Kaip naudoti funkciją „COUNTIF“ programoje „Excel“
Kaip naudotis „SUMIF“ funkcija „Excel“